Elimate the need to looping and make cpumask_any_but() a macro to wrap around cpumask_first_but(), just like cpumask_any() does, to make it more consistence. The change brings some benefit in terms of code size shrinking of vmlinux, for NR_CPUS=3D64, it reduce 78 bytes in total, for NR_CPUS=3D4096, it reduce 2 bytes in total. The details are shown in the table [1]. Performance test is done using the test script [2]. Running the test for 10000 times, the origin implementation of cpumask_any_but() use 19665287 nanoseconds in total, the new version of it, which is a wrapper around cpumask_first_but(), uses 19545574 nanoseconds. The difference is 119713 nanoseconds. The logic is the same here, using the new helper will make it more conscious. However, no benefit in code size or performance as the implementation behind the helper is in fact the same as the one used here.
